Permila borealis Martynova 1961 (scorpionfly)

Insecta - Mecoptera - Permotipulidae

Alternative combination: Permotipula borealis

Full reference: O. M. Martynova. 1961. Neuropteroidea, Mecopteroidea, Trichoptera in Paleozoiskie nasekomye kuznetskogo basseina. Akademiya Nauk SSSR, Trudy Paleontologicheskogo Instituta 85:469-593

Belongs to Permila according to V. G. Novokshonov 1997

See also Evenhuis 1994, Martynova 1961, Willmann 1978 and Willmann 1989

Sister taxa: none

Type specimen: PIN 676/583, a forewing. Its type locality is Suriekova I, ditch 6 (PIN collection 676), which is in a Wordian terrestrial siliciclastic in the Kazankovo-Markinskaya Formation of the Russian Federation.

Ecology:

Distribution: found only at Suriekova I, ditch 6 (PIN collection 676)
